A group of Form 1 students from the Bishop’s Conservatory Secondary School in Victoria, were taken on field trip to Dwejra in order for them to be able to observe a number of animals and plants, including some endemic species.
This Science Fieldwork and Maths Trail took place as part of the Form 1 science syllabus and was also combined with a maths trail, organised for the same students.
The students said that they found the trip a very interesting and enjoyable, educational experience.
